Course structure

• Overview of Geotechnical Engineering in Humanitarian Projects
• Ground Improvement Methods for Religious Structures
• Seismic Design Considerations for Religious Buildings
• Soil-Structure Interaction in Foundation Design
• Geotechnical Risk Management in Humanitarian Projects
• Geotechnical Investigation Techniques for Religious Sites
• Sustainable Construction Practices for Religious Projects
• Case Studies of Geotechnical Challenges in Humanitarian Projects
• Community Engagement and Cultural Sensitivity in Geotechnical Design
